CentOS上带有Phalcon的系统日志

CentOS上带有Phalcon的系统日志,centos,syslog,phalcon,Centos,Syslog,Phalcon,有人在CentOS和Phalcon一起工作吗 我正在尝试从使用Syslog,但找不到在哪里可以看到输出。好了,CentOS向'/var/log/messages'发送系统日志消息,但我查看了'/var/log'中的几乎所有文件,没有发现任何内容 目前,我正在以以下方式构造系统日志: $logger = new SyslogAdapter(null); 我在Phalcon或我的操作系统上是否缺少任何设置?查看,Phalcon似乎将所有调用都代理为默认值 我想在没有Phalcon的情况下,让它在纯

有人在CentOS和Phalcon一起工作吗

我正在尝试从使用Syslog,但找不到在哪里可以看到输出。好了,CentOS向'/var/log/messages'发送系统日志消息,但我查看了'/var/log'中的几乎所有文件,没有发现任何内容

目前,我正在以以下方式构造系统日志:

$logger = new SyslogAdapter(null);
我在Phalcon或我的操作系统上是否缺少任何设置?

查看,Phalcon似乎将所有调用都代理为默认值

我想在没有Phalcon的情况下,让它在纯php中工作。它认为这是问题的关键所在

更新

只要查看一下您的代码,实际的类称为Syslog,而不是SyslogAdapter,除非您使用Phalcon\Logger\Adapter\Syslog作为SyslogAdapter,我从上面的代码看不出来:)如果通过php的syslog有效,那么问题很可能出在您的代码上。我刚刚尝试了以下方法,效果如预期:

$logger = new Syslog(null);
$logger->log('test', 'hello world');

// 27/04/2014 19:15:24.922 php[24030]: hello world

通过PHP的Syslog运行良好<代码>日志信息按预期转到
var/LOG/messages
。更新答案,检查是否正确导入该类。